EX15TI NG EX 15TI NG KITCHEN BEDROOM EXI5TINO LIVING : 856 5F NEW LIVINO AREA: 4ci(q 5F E:XISTINO FRONT PORCH: 120 5F TOTAL: 1472 5R FLOOR PLAN 1/4' - P-0' Basic Building Structural Information This table was prepared using Windload Calculator Plus Software available from www.windcalcs.com This information was created in accordance with Chapter 16 of the 2020 Florida Building Code. The Component and Cladding Pressures were generated using the method in Part 2 of Chapter 30 of ASC,E 7-16. Floor & Roof Live Loads { .R-3 • Single -Family Dwellings) Attics: 20 psf w/ storage, 10 psf w/o storage Habitable Attics, Bedroom: 30 psf All Other Rooms: 40 psf Garage: 40 psf Roofs 20 psf (Balcony and Deck live loads are 150% of the adjacent space served.) Wind Design Data Ultimate Wind Speed: 137 mph Nominal Wind Speed: 106 mph Risk Category: 11 Wind Exposure: B Enclosure Classification: Enclosed End Zone Width (a): 4.00 ft. Internal Pressure Coefficient: 0.18 Roof Geometry: Gable Roof Slope: 4.0 in 12 ( 18.40) Mean Roof Height: 12 ft. (The Ultimate Wind speed was used to determine the Component and. Cladding design pressures.) (This Building is not in a Wind -Borne Debris Region, and opening protection is not required.) Components and Cladding Roof Zone 1: +16.8 psf max., -51.2 psf min. Roof Zone 2e: +16.8 psf max., -51.2 psf min. Roof Zone 2n: +16.8 psf max., -74.7 psf min. Roof Zone 2r: +16.8 psf max., -74.7 psf min. Roof Zone 3e: +16.8 psf max., -74.7 psf min. Roof Zone 3r: +16.8 psf max., -88.8 psf min. Overhang at Roof Zone 1: -58.7 psf min. Overhang at Roof Zone 2e: -58.7 psf min. Overhang at Roof Zone 2n: -82.2 psf min. Overhang at Roof Zone 2r: -82.2 psf min. Overhang at Roof Zone 3e: -96.3 psf min. Overhang at Roof Zone 3r: -112.7 psf min. Wall Zone 4: +27.7 psf max., -30.0 psf min. Wall Zone 5: +27.7 psf max., -37.1 psf min. OUTLETS NOT REQUIRED TO BE ON A (6FI) CIRCUIT ARE REQUIRED TO BE ON A ARG-FAULT CIRCUIT (AFI). SMOKE DETECTORS ARE REQUIRED IN EACH BEDROOM AND HALLHAY5 ADJACENT TO BEDROOMS. SMOKE DETECTORS SHOULD BE PLACE IN KITCHEN AND OTHER LIVING AREAS AS, REQUIRED BY THE FLORIDA RE51DENTIAL BUILDING CODE 2020 7TH EDITION. CARBON MONOXIDE DETECTORS ARE REQUIRED AT ALL SLEEPING AREAS WHEN F0551L FUELS ARE USED IN HOME, HOME HAS A FIREPLACE OR HOME HAS AN ATTACHED GARAGE.
